The story follows Dolley Madison's evolution from a young girl to the First Lady of the United States. While it focuses on the famous 1812 evacuation of the White House, it also highlights the emotional resilience required to protect a nation's treasures while others are fleeing in panic. It frames history not just as a series of dates, but as a series of choices made by brave individuals under pressure.
